Default can\'t open pro tools after install eqIII plug-in

After downloading and installing my new eqIII plug-in, I cannot open the pro tools application. I recieve the message "The application 'Pro Tools' could not be launched because of a shared library error:<Pro Tools PPCdbg><MultiShellCode><DSI><DsiDoHostCommand>" How can I solve this problem? I guess it΄s the only way. Not lucky enough that EQIII works with 6.4,the fact remains that all the digi plug-ins required an update within the 6.4 release:



Quote:
Important Information About Pro Tools LE 6.4 Plug-In Updates

Except where noted, plug-ins on this page are included on the Pro Tools LE 6.4 Update CDs, and the Pro Tools LE 6.4 and LE CDs included with upgrades and new purchases.

In order to greatly reduce the size of the web downloads, these optional plug-ins are NOT INCLUDED with the Pro Tools LE 6.4 downloads. All Digidesign and Digi-distributed plug-ins must be updated in order to work with Pro Tools LE 6.4.

After running the Pro Tools 6.4 LE web update, you must download updates for any of these plug-ins that you own and install them after installing Pro Tools BEFORE launching Pro Tools. Otherwise an error and possible crash will occur on Pro Tools launch.


which means that basically all DIGI plugs are not compatible between the 6.1.x and 6.4 releases.
